The patch below adds the ability to say:
../test_parrot -f - < foo.pbc
(Yes, an interactive bytecode interpreter, just what you've been
waiting for)
and
../test_parrot -f foo.pbc
And have them both do the same thing.
This seems to work fine on FreeBSD and Irix, but might be very wrong
somewhere else, could someone with a windows box give it a whirl or
anyone with any flame produce it now...
